Reality check as Kenya Sevens lose to Germany

Kenya Sevens stars Anthony Omondi and Patrick Odongo (left).[World Rugby]

Kenya Sevens were handed a reality check on Saturday after losing 24-12 to Germany in their last Group C match at the ongoing World Rugby Challenger Series in

Indiscipline and laxity cost Kenya the game as the two sides renewed rivalry after earlier meeting during the 2023 Safari Sevens where Shujaa emerged 19-7 winners.

Shujaa star player Kevin Wekesa was sent to the bin early in the game, a numerical advantage the Germans took advantage of to lead 5-0 after John Dawe touched down an unconverted try in the third minute.

Rising star Patrick Odongo responded for Kenya after exploding rom the wings to score a try that Anthony Omondi converted for a 7-5 lead.

At the start of the second half, Tim Lichtenberg bagged two tries before  Odongo burst on the right-side wing for a try that cut the gap to 5 points.  Lichtenberg completed his hattrick for a 24-12 win for Germany.

Kenya 7s will now shift focus on the Cup quarters.

Shujaa begun the games on Friday with a convincing 41-0 win over Mexico before seeing off Uganda 29-7.
